Understanding cottage food regulations
Cottage food laws are designed to enable individuals to prepare and sell food from their homes, thus promoting small food businesses and local economies. These laws recognize the value of home-based food production, empowering many to turn their culinary passions into viable businesses. Cottage food regulations differ from state to state, but they typically cover safety standards, permissible food types, and operational guidelines.
Health agencies and environmental health departments play crucial roles in overseeing these laws. They ensure that cottage food operations comply with safety standards to protect public health. These agencies provide the guidelines for safe food handling, storage, and preparation, which are critical to preventing foodborne illnesses and maintaining quality.
Cottage food operation registration overview
When considering a cottage food operation, it’s essential to understand the types of permits available. Typically, operations fall into Class A and Class B categories. Class A permits allow sales only directly to consumers, like at farmers' markets or through online orders, while Class B permits often allow for broader sales opportunities, such as retail locations.
Eligibility criteria for registration vary widely by state. Usually, applicants must be over 18 years of age and comply with their state’s health department requirements, which may involve completing specific training courses on food safety.
The cottage food registration packet form
The cottage food registration packet form is a crucial document that prospective cottage food operators must complete to legally start their business. This packet typically includes essential components such as personal information, types of foods being sold, and operational plans. Providing accurate and comprehensive information is vital, as incorrect details may lead to delays or rejections in the application process.
An accurately filled registration packet not only expedites the approval process but also helps operators prepare for compliance with safety standards from the get-go, setting the stage for a successful food business.

Inspection processes for cottage food operations
For Class B operators, inspection is often a required step before launching your cottage food business. The health department will outline when inspections take place, typically before your operation can legally start. To prepare, ensure your kitchen is compliant with health and safety standards, and familiarize yourself with the common concerns that inspectors will assess.
Maintaining compliance not only aids in passing inspections but also contributes to the overall quality and safety of your products, reassuring customers of their wellbeing.
